Personal Injury
While boating accidents can result in serious injuries, many of them are preventable. Untrained and inexperienced boaters are the main cause of boat accidents along with other reckless choices, such as operating under the influence, transporting too many passengers, or reckless behavior. The severity of injuries ranges from minor bruises to paralysis caused by spinal cord or brain injury.
Victims injured in a boating accident may receive compensation for their medical expenses and loss of income or work as they recover. If their injuries are severe they may also be able to recover expenses for long-term care. Unfortunately it is difficult to estimate the value of a personal injury claim isn't an easy task. Insurance firms often attempt to make a deal that is less than what victims are entitled to. A knowledgeable attorney can help you to fight for the highest possible settlement.

Maritime Workers' Compensation
Workers on workboats and other vessels, such as supply ships, are subject to dangerous conditions during their employment. They are at risk of being injured not just by cargo or equipment falling, but also by boat accidents caused by the negligence or recklessness of other parties on board the vessel.
The Jones Act and other federal statutes protect seamen from employer negligence. They are entitled to full compensation under the Longshore and Harbor Workers' Compensation Act. These damages may include medical expenses loss of income, cost of living during recovery from injuries, pain and suffering and other financial benefits.
Many times, injured seamen on a supply vessel, tugboats, dredgers, oil tanks, barges cruise boats, or sightseeing vessels require more than workers' compensation to compensate for their expenses. A knowledgeable New York boat accident lawyer can help identify other third-party claims where a seaman may be able to claim compensation, for instance, allegations of unseaworthiness and the employer's inability to maintain an appropriate vessel.

Product Defects
While most boat accidents occur due to reckless or negligent behavior on the part of the boat owner There are also instances where a crash is actually caused by faulty equipment. In these instances, victims can seek compensation from company that produced the defective product in a lawsuit. In these situations, a Reston, VA product defect lawyer can help.
Defective equipment and boats may be covered under strict liability, negligence, or warranty law. Warranty claims can be based on a breach of implied or express guarantees provided by law, such as the New Jersey lemon laws for used cars or the warranties of merchantability or the fit and finish of the Uniform Commercial Code.
Latent defects are usually covered by insurance policies as well. Although some consumers may claim that the issue is evident or obvious, courts often require expert testimony from a surveyor or other expert to determine if the mechanical breakdown or damage resulted from an unnoticed problem.
Some defects are found after a boat has been sold. These defects are usually considered manufacturing defects, and the manufacturer is accountable for these. Others are discovered after the vessel is in operation and may be the fault of the owner. One example is when a boat owner forgets to drain water from the engine, and that water freezes in the winter and damages the motor.
